Systematic Review Shows That Work Done by Storm Waves Can Be Misinterpreted as Tsunami-Related Because Commonly Used Hydrodynamic Equations Are Flawed ArchiMer
Cox, Rónadh; Ardhuin, Fabrice; Dias, Frédéric; Autret, Ronan; Beisiegel, Nicole; Earlie, Claire S.; Herterich, James G.; Kennedy, Andrew; Paris, Raphaël; Raby, Alison; Schmitt, Pal; Weiss, Robert.
Coastal boulder deposits (CBD), transported by waves at elevations above sea level and substantial distances inland, are markers for marine incursions. Whether they are tsunami or storm deposits can be difficult to determine, but this is of critical importance because of the role that CBD play in coastal hazard analysis. Equations from seminal work by Nott (1997), here referred to as the Nott Approach, are commonly employed to calculate nominal wave heights from boulder masses as a means to discriminate between emplacement mechanisms. Systematic review shows that this approach is based on assumptions that are not securely founded and that direct relationships cannot be established between boulder measurements and wave heights. Submarine platform development by erosion of a Surtseyan cone at Capelinhos, Faial Island, Azores ArchiMer
Zhao, Zhongwei; Mitchell, Neil C.; Quartau, Rui; Tempera, Fernando; Bricheno, Lucy.
Erosion of volcanic islands ultimately creates shallow banks and guyots, but the ways in which erosion proceeds to create them over time and how the coastline retreat rate relates to wave conditions, rock mass strength and other factors are unclear. The Capelinhos volcano was formed in 1957/58 during a Surtseyan and partly effusive eruption that added an ~2.5 km2 tephra and lava promontory to the western end of Faial Island (Azores, central North Atlantic). Subsequent coastal and submarine erosion has reduced the subaerial area of the promontory and created a submarine platform. A comprehensive hydro-geomorphic study of cliff-top storm deposits on Banneg Island during winter 2013–2014 ArchiMer
Autret, Ronan; Dodet, Guillaume; Fichaut, Bernard; Suanez, Serge; David, Laurence; Leckler, Fabien; Ardhuin, Fabrice; Ammann, Jerome; Grandjean, Philippe; Allemand, Pascal; Filipot, Jean-francois.
Large clastic cliff-top storm deposits (called CTSDs) are one of the most remarkable signatures that characterizes extreme storm wave events on coastal cliffs. Hence, the study of CTSDs is of key importance for understanding and predicting the impacts of extreme storm wave events on rocky coasts or establishing proxies for storm intensity. The present study uses new data including hydrodynamic measurements in both deep and intertidal waters, and records of CTSDs displacement and deposition across Banneg Island during the stormy winter 2013–2014. Two drone-based surveys were carried out in January 2013 (pre-storms) and in April 2014 (post-storms). Sedimentation, transport und erosion an der Nordküste Kolumbiens zwischen Barranquilla und der Sierra Nevada de Santa Marta OceanDocs
Erffa, A. Frhr. von.
El Río Magdalena desemboca actualmente en el mar Caribe, por el extremo occidental de este territorio y ha formado varios deltas, estos se han originado en tres fases comprendidas en el cuaternario reciente. Los dos más antiguos quedaron destruidos por la erosión y solamente son detectados en la morfología submarina. El delta siguiente en antigüedad, alcanzó su mayor amplitud hace 2.400 años aproximadamente La etapa de destrucción de este delta se inició por aquellos tiempos, y aún continua en actividad. El delta más reciente se está formando al frente de la boca actual del Río Magdalena. Geomorfología y dinámica costera OceanDocs
Codignotto, J..
In Argentine coastal areas, geomorphological changes are directly related to relative continental uplifts and falls and to seaward and landward displacement of the coastline. Accretional and erosional phenomena are produced by displacement of the coastline in horizontal way. The resultant structures can be represented in two principal sectors. Backward motion or retrogradation of about 15 km were estimated for the Strait of Magellan, over an area of 500 km 2.Otherwise, large accretional phenomena were recognized in the north,with a 60 km seaward displacement, equivalent to 4,000 km2 in the last7.000 years. Remote Sensing for Studying Nearshore Bottom Morphology and Shoreline Changes OceanDocs
Shaghude, Y.W..
The major objective of the present study is to demonstrate how remote sensing approach can be used for studying nearshore bottom morphology and shoreline changes in coastal Tanzania. Two study sites were used. In the first site, remote sensing satellite Landsat Thematic Mapper data was evaluated against known water depths from conventional echo sounding measurement taken on the eastern side of the channel. The correlation between the remote sensing data and the echo sounding mesurement was rather satisfactory, suggesting that the approach can roughly be used to investigate sea bottom morphology in the nearshore areas.
